U.S. Energy Secretary Pledges to Reverse Focus on Climate Change

  • Top energy industry leaders gathered in Houston for the CERA conference to discuss fossil fuels.
  • An $18 billion expansion of a liquefied natural gas export facility in Louisiana was announced, highlighting a reversal of the Biden administration's freeze on new LNG permits.
  • Jonathan Elkind stated that U.S. LNG has been crucial for Europe in reducing dependence on Russian gas following the invasion of Ukraine.
  • Some analysts believe that Trump's energy strategy could impact U.S. And European energy dynamics, especially regarding LNG exports.
